I had interesting awareness on Yom Kippur, where I thought of psychodrama foundational goals. On Kol Nidre, there is releasing of vows.....for the coming year! Seems ass-backwards. Yet has a purpose: living spontaneously is a most Holy act.
In a (very) progressive, Kabbalah oriented, translation:
"Concerning all vows, oaths, covenants, promises and all manner of bindings of the soul with which I will bind and limit myself, constrain and confine myself from this Yom Kippur until the next Yom Kippur, I proclaim: I hereby recant, release, disavow, and declare null and void from this time forward. The bindings shall not bind me, the roles I take on shall not constrain me, and the limitations shall not in any way limit my power. "
Aquarian Minyon Prayerbook
